Which device would most likely be used to manage and monitor entry to a secure data center using authentication factors like badges and biometric data?
A physical access control device is designed to secure environments by restricting and monitoring physical entry using various forms of authentication. Badges and biometric data are commonly used as authentication methods with these systems. While routers and firewalls are important for network security, they do not manage physical entry. A VPN headend is used for creating and managing virtual private networks, not for physical access control.
